Is there any easy-tool for the calculation of cold-formed steel structures in Europe?
In USA there is the Prescriptive Method which allows designing a simple cold-formed steel structure in a simple way by means of a series of tables. In Canada, CCSBI offers also tables for the easy design of cold-formed steel members. However, these methods cannot be directly extrapolated to the European case, due to the differences between the relevant design codes. With this idea in mind, Arcelor Research Liège in collaboration with Bureau Greisch elaborated a European Prescriptive Method based on Eurocodes. The method allowed designing simple steel houses of 1 or two-storeys by means of tables and abacuses.
